package bridge_test
import (
"context"
"fmt"
"testing"
"github.com/ProtonMail/go-proton-api"
"github.com/ProtonMail/go-proton-api/server"
"github.com/ProtonMail/proton-bridge/v3/internal/bridge"
"github.com/ProtonMail/proton-bridge/v3/internal/constants"
"github.com/ProtonMail/proton-bridge/v3/internal/events"
"github.com/bradenaw/juniper/iterator"
"github.com/emersion/go-imap/client"
"github.com/golang/mock/gomock"
"github.com/stretchr/testify/require"
)
func TestBridge_Refresh(t *testing.T) {
withEnv(t, func(ctx context.Context, s *server.Server, netCtl *proton.NetCtl, locator bridge.Locator, storeKey []byte) {
userID, _, err := s.CreateUser("imap", password)
require.NoError(t, err)
names := iterator.Collect(iterator.Map(iterator.Counter(10), func(i int) string {
return fmt.Sprintf("folder%v", i)
}))
for _, name := range names {
must(s.CreateLabel(userID, name, "", proton.LabelTypeFolder))
}
// The initial user should be fully synced.
withBridge(ctx, t, s.GetHostURL(), netCtl, locator, storeKey, func(b *bridge.Bridge, _ *bridge.Mocks) {
syncCh, done := chToType[events.Event, events.SyncFinished](b.GetEvents(events.SyncFinished{}))
defer done()
userID, err := b.LoginFull(ctx, "imap", password, nil, nil)
require.NoError(t, err)
require.Equal(t, userID, (<-syncCh).UserID)
})
// If we then connect an IMAP client, it should see all the labels with UID validity of 1.
withBridge(ctx, t, s.GetHostURL(), netCtl, locator, storeKey, func(b *bridge.Bridge, mocks *bridge.Mocks) {
mocks.Reporter.EXPECT().ReportMessageWithContext(gomock.Any(), gomock.Any()).AnyTimes()
info, err := b.GetUserInfo(userID)
require.NoError(t, err)
require.True(t, info.State == bridge.Connected)
client, err := client.Dial(fmt.Sprintf("%v:%v", constants.Host, b.GetIMAPPort()))
require.NoError(t, err)
require.NoError(t, client.Login(info.Addresses[0], string(info.BridgePass)))
defer func() { _ = client.Logout() }()
for _, name := range names {
status, err := client.Select("Folders/"+name, false)
require.NoError(t, err)
require.Equal(t, uint32(1000), status.UidValidity)
}
})
// Refresh the user; this will force a resync.
require.NoError(t, s.RefreshUser(userID, proton.RefreshAll))
// If we then connect an IMAP client, it should see all the labels with UID validity of 1.
withBridge(ctx, t, s.GetHostURL(), netCtl, locator, storeKey, func(b *bridge.Bridge, mocks *bridge.Mocks) {
mocks.Reporter.EXPECT().ReportMessageWithContext(gomock.Any(), gomock.Any()).AnyTimes()
syncCh, done := chToType[events.Event, events.SyncFinished](b.GetEvents(events.SyncFinished{}))
defer done()
require.Equal(t, userID, (<-syncCh).UserID)
})
// After resync, the IMAP client should see all the labels with UID validity of 2.
withBridge(ctx, t, s.GetHostURL(), netCtl, locator, storeKey, func(b *bridge.Bridge, mocks *bridge.Mocks) {
mocks.Reporter.EXPECT().ReportMessageWithContext(gomock.Any(), gomock.Any()).AnyTimes()
info, err := b.GetUserInfo(userID)
require.NoError(t, err)
require.True(t, info.State == bridge.Connected)
client, err := client.Dial(fmt.Sprintf("%v:%v", constants.Host, b.GetIMAPPort()))
require.NoError(t, err)
require.NoError(t, client.Login(info.Addresses[0], string(info.BridgePass)))
defer func() { _ = client.Logout() }()
for _, name := range names {
status, err := client.Select("Folders/"+name, false)
require.NoError(t, err)
require.Equal(t, uint32(1001), status.UidValidity)
}
})
})
}
